  • Patent number: 7677676
    Abstract: A vehicle wheel for a double-track vehicle or an external cover therefor is provided, having passage openings, particularly for a cooling air flow for a wheel brake provided on the interior side of the wheel, in the lateral projection. The passage openings have a width in the radial direction which changes when viewed in the circumferential direction such that, viewed against the rotating direction of the wheel when the vehicle is driving forward, the above-mentioned width Viewed in the radial direction, centers of the virtual segments of the passage opening which follow one another against the rotating direction move in the direction of the wheel center. As a result, the force as well as the lever arm of the drag is reduced, so that a moment of resistance is obtained which is significantly decreased. The passage openings are preferably bounded by spokes extending essentially in the radial direction.

  • Patent number: 7587825
    Abstract: A method of forming a wheel disc starts with a flat blank. A plurality of windows are formed in the wheel disc, wherein each window has a respective outer edge proximate with a continuous outer band around a periphery of the wheel disc. The windows define a plurality of spokes between adjacent windows, and the angular size of each of the windows along the outer band is preferably greater than the angular size of each of the spokes. The outer band is partially closed toward a cylindrical shape by engaging a cam die against at least a portion of the outer band. The outer band is substantially fully closed into a cylindrical shape by axially wiping the outer band using a cylindrical die. The intermediate camming operation achieves the desired final shape after wiping without introducing stresses that would weaken or distort the wheel disc.

  • Patent number: 7346984
    Abstract: A wheel, particularly a light metal wheel, for motor vehicles, essentially consists of a spoke wheel center (20) and a rim (10). In order to reduce weight and increase the bending strength, which is of great significance in regard to contact with curbstones and potholes, profile segment (31) in the form of half-shell units, which forms a continuous hollow chamber (41) in the direction of the circumference, at least in sections, are provided in the area of an external base of the rim (14).
